Kount launches service to catch criminal and 'friendly' cyber fraud

October 30, 2019

Kount, a Boise, Idaho-based cybersecurity firm, launched what it calls the industry's first comprehensive service that protects digital companies against both criminal and friendly fraud.

Kount said the service, called the Friendly Fraud Prevention Solution, is designed to protect merchants and other companies against hackers and first person fraud, which is sometimes called chargeback fraud or consumer abuse. 

"Digital businesses today face many threats, from organized criminal fraud rings to competitive threats to threats against their own customers," Brad Wiskirchen, CEO of Kount, told Mobile Payments Today via email. "Friendly fraud, made up of chargebacks and lost goods due to intentional and unintentional exploitation of disputes by real customers, can account for up to 40% to 80% of all fraud losses.”

He said the Kount service, which utilizes AI and machine learning, detects pre- and post-transaction fraud and provides a first-line defense against transaction disputes.

The service features a technology called Visa Merchant Purchase Inquiry, which is part of Visa's claims resolution process, which is designed to reduce chargebacks and cut dispute resolution time.
